RIP (ripped, ripping)

Pronunciation (US): 

 Dictionary entry overview: What does rip mean? 

RIP (noun)
  The noun RIP has 4 senses:

1. a dissolute man in fashionable society
2. an opening made forcibly as by pulling apart
3. a stretch of turbulent water in a river or the sea caused by one current flowing into or across another current
4. the act of rending or ripping or splitting something

  Familiarity information: RIP used as a noun is uncommon.


RIP (verb)
  The verb RIP has 4 senses:

1. tear or be torn violently
2. move precipitously or violently
3. cut (wood) along the grain
4. criticize or abuse strongly and violently

  Familiarity information: RIP used as a verb is uncommon.
